Frequently Asked Questions About Sports Betting in Atlantic City
1. Is Sports Betting Legal In Atlantic City?
Yes, sports betting is legal in Atlantic City. In 2018, the U.S. Supreme Court struck down the federal ban on sports betting, allowing states like New Jersey to regulate their own sports wagering markets.

3. Do I Need To Be Physically Present In Atlantic City To Bet On Sports?
No, while you can bet in person at casinos in Atlantic City, you also have the option to place bets online. Many Atlantic City casinos offer sports betting apps and websites for convenient wagering from anywhere in New Jersey.

5. Are There Any Age Restrictions For Sports Betting In Atlantic City?
Yes, you must be at least 21 years old to legally engage in sports betting in Atlantic City, whether in-person or online.
6. What Are The Taxes On Sports Betting Winnings In Atlantic City?
Winnings from sports betting in Atlantic City are subject to federal and state taxes. It’s important to keep track of your wins and losses for accurate reporting during tax season.

9. Is Sports Betting Legal In Atlantic City For Online Platforms?
Yes, sports betting is legal in Atlantic City for online platforms as long as you are located within New Jersey. You can access various online sportsbooks that are licensed to operate in the state.
